Baixe o app para aproveitar ainda mais
Prévia do material em texto
1 Análise de Sistemas Prof. Carlos Souza � Sistemas � Análise de Sistemas � Participantes da Análise de Sistemas Agenda Objetivos 3 � Conhecer os conceitos de sistema, análise de sistemas e seus componentes. � Um conjunto de elementos interconectados harmonicamente, de modo a formar um todo organizado. É uma definição que acontece em várias Sistema � É uma definição que acontece em várias disciplinas, como biologia, medicina, informática, administração. � Vindo do grego o termo "sistema" significa "combinar", "ajustar", "formar um conjunto". � Um conjunto ou disposição de elementos que é organizado para executar certo método, procedimento ou controle ao processar informações de um modo automatizado. Sistema 1 2 3 6 5 4 SistemaEntrada Saída � Elementos de um sistema baseado em computador: � Documentos: Manuais, formulários e outras informações descritivas que retratam o uso e/ou operação do sistema; Sistema operação do sistema; � Procedimentos: Os passos que definem o uso específico de cada elemento do sistema ou o contexto processual em que o sistema reside; � Hardware: Dispositivos eletrônicos (ex.: CPU, Memória, Processador, etc) que fornecem capacidade ao computador, e os dispositivos eletromecânicos (ex.: sensores, motores) que fornecem funções ao mundo externo; � (...) � Pessoas: Usuários e operadores de software e hardware; � Banco de dados: Uma grande e organizada coleção Sistema Banco de dados: Uma grande e organizada coleção de informações a que se tem acesso pelo software e faz parte integrante da função do sistema. � É o processo de: � Analisar; � Projetar; � Implementar; Avaliar sistemas voltados a fornecer informações que Análise de Sistemas � Avaliar sistemas voltados a fornecer informações que sirvam de apoio às operações e aos processos de tomada de decisão em uma empresa. � Concentra-se em todos os elementos do sistema, não apenas no software. � É o conjunto de procedimentos que procedem a elaboração ou escolha de um programa ou sistema informatizado. A análise de sistema visa atender as especificações dadas para a Análise de Sistemas visa atender as especificações dadas para a resolução de um problema específico, minimizando os custos, o trabalho humano e outros fatores, maximizando a eficácia do sistema em tempo e em capacidade. Fonte:http://www.digitro.com/ � É uma profissão, cujas responsabilidades concentram-se na análise do sistema e na administração de sistemas computacionais. Cabe a este profissional parte da organização, implantação e manutenção de aplicativos e redes de computadores, Análise de Sistemas manutenção de aplicativos e redes de computadores, ou seja, o analista de sistemas é o responsável pelo levantamento de informações sobre uma empresa a fim de utilizá-las no desenvolvimento de um sistema para a mesma ou para o levantamento de uma necessidade específica do cliente para desenvolver este programa especifico com base nas informações colhidas. Fonte: Wikipédia � Dificuldades: � É difícil efetuar a análise de um sistema, porque um conceito nebuloso deve ser transformado num conjunto concreto de elementos inteligíveis. Análise de Sistemas � A comunicação é essencial na análise, desentendimento, omissão, inconsistência e erro são frequentes (Gerencia de Comunicação). � Dificuldades: � Lidar com a ambiguidade; � Identificar corretamente os requisitos; � Especificar adequadamente a solução; Análise de Sistemas � Especificar adequadamente a solução; � Lidar com interesses incompatíveis; � Gerir a mudança. Análise de Sistemas � Participantes � Analistas de Sistemas; � Usuário; � Gerentes; Análise de Sistemas � Gerentes; � Auditores / Avaliadores de Qualidade; � Administrador de Dados � Programadores; � Pessoal Operativo � Suporte, comunicação, hardware. � Objetivo “Desenvolver um sistema de informações útil e Analista de Sistemas “Desenvolver um sistema de informações útil e de alta qualidade, que satisfaça as exigências do usuário final” Edward Yourdon � Além de se preocupar com o desenvolvimento de software, o analista terá de considerar o hardware, as pessoas que o operam, entrada de dados, segurança, auditoria - em resumo, Analista de Sistemas de dados, segurança, auditoria - em resumo, todos os componentes do sistema. � Algumas funções do Analista de Sistemas: � Planejar, supervisionar e coordenar a análise e o levantamento de serviços, identificando suas principais características e estudando a Analista de Sistemas principais características e estudando a viabilidade econômica e técnica das soluções possíveis, propondo conseqüentemente alterações, visando a melhoria no desempenho. � Definir e supervisionar a construção e implantação de novos sistemas; � Coordenar e orientar as revisões de projetos; � (...) � Supervisionar diretamente a elaboração da documentação em nível de sistema; � Validar a solução implementada, verificando se todos Analista de Sistemas � Validar a solução implementada, verificando se todos os requisitos foram implementados e orientando a realização de testes; � Propor soluções para os problemas; � Determinar se técnica e economicamente é rentável a utilização de um sistema de tratamento automático de informação. � É a pessoa para quem o sistema será construído. O contato entre o analista e os usuários deve ser constante; Deve estar informado de todas as fases do Usuário � Deve estar informado de todas as fases do desenvolvimento. Manter reuniões semanais ou quinzenais para acompanhamento do projeto; � Os usuários são muito heterogêneos, e apresentam características distintas. Podemos classificá-los por: � Tipo de função; � Nível de experiência. Usuário � Nível de experiência. � Usuário Operacional � Dentre todos os possíveis tipos de usuário, este é aquele que terá o maior contato com o sistema. (ex.: secretarias, pessoal de entrada de pedido, caixas, Usuário secretarias, pessoal de entrada de pedido, caixas, etc); � Eles são muito interessados nas funções do sistema (aspectos de interface); � Tem uma visão local do sistema. (Apenas as funções relacionadas diretamente com a sua função). � Usuário Executivo � São as pessoas interessadas no funcionamento geral do sistema; � Necessitam de informações refinadas do sistema Usuário � Necessitam de informações refinadas do sistema para poder auxiliar na tomada de decisão; � É o responsável pelas finanças do projeto. � Relacionamento � A definição das funções principais do sistema (casos de uso) ficam a cargo de um, ou mais, usuários supervisores. Indicarão o que é Usuário usuários supervisores. Indicarão o que é necessário para melhorar o desempenho da empresa; � Para definir como automatizar estas funções é necessário usuários operativos, pois eles que utilizam e sabem o que precisam; � (...) � Por fim, o projeto e dúvidas relacionadas a prazos devem ser discutidas com usuários Executivos, junto com alguns supervisores. Usuário � Nível de Experiência: � Usuário amador: funcionário com pouco conhecimento em informática. Apresenta um resistência considerável a Computação. Usuário resistência considerável a Computação. � Novato: Acham que sabem tudo do sistema. Usuário com um pouco de conhecimento, mas não apresenta a maturidade adequada (“arrogantes”). � Experientes: São aqueles que realmente sabem (“humildes”). � Gerentes Usuários (usuário supervisor): Se importa com os relatórios internos e tendências de curto prazo; � Gerente Geral: Normalmente estão mais Gerentes � Gerente Geral: Normalmente estão mais interessados nas informaçõesde planejamento estratégico e de apoio à decisão; � Gerente de projeto: Analista de sistemas responsável pelo projeto. � Controle de Qualidade; � Participam da padronização do projeto; � Estão presentes no final de todas a fases de um sistema; Auditores de Qualidade um sistema; � Verificam se a equipe de desenvolvimento esta utilizando a Engenharia de software de modo adequado. Não desenvolvem nada. Apenas monitoram o desenvolvimento. � Responsáveis pela gestão e padronização dos dados da aplicação. Administrador de Dados � Responsáveis pela programação e pelo CPD (rede, segurança, hardware, etc.). Programação / Suporte
Compartilhar